NAVTEQ(R) Map Data of Brazil Selected by Digital Life to Power G31 PND Print E-mail

High-quality data and superior technical support make NAVTEQ a smart choice for Digital Life



CHICAGO, Dec. 14 -- NAVTEQ, the leading global provider of digital map, traffic and location data for in-vehicle, portable, wireless and enterprise solutions, has been selected by Digital Life, a Brazil-based electronics provider, to supply map data for the new, G31 Digital Life PND which launched in November. NAVTEQ's high quality map data and extensive customer and technical support were deciding factors in Digital Life's choice to utilize NAVTEQ map data of Brazil to power the Route 66 navigation application featured in the G31 Digital Life PND.

Benefits of the G31 Digital Life PND are a 3.5 inch LCD touch screen, voice guidance and access to a variety of multimedia features such as videos, music, e-books and photos. The G31 Digital Life PND utilizes the NAVTEQ map of Brazil and Route 66's navigation application to provide users with a driving experience featuring turn-by-turn guidance, extensive Points of Interests as well as broad and comprehensive city coverage. The NAVTEQ map of Brazil includes 1,259 cities across Brazil and contains a superb listing of 644,000 Points of Interest (POIs) like pharmacies, banks and restaurants enabling G31 users to select their destination either by address or the POI listing.

"We are pleased to work with such a well-regarded, local company like Digital Life, which recognizes the impact a high-quality map and content make to the overall consumer navigation experience," stated Helder de Azevedo, general director-Latin America, NAVTEQ.  "We look forward to a mutually beneficial relationship."

"We know that NAVTEQ is recognized as the leading global provider of map data; however, it was their collaborative approach to working with us that ultimately led us to choose them as the map provider for the G31," stated Xu Wei, president-Digital Life. "As a company known for exceptional customer support, we have high expectations regarding this area of service, and NAVTEQ exceeded our expectations."

Known for their quality, NAVTEQ maps are built to a single data specification allowing customers to easily and cost-effectively move into new markets by optimizing their development efforts in one country for use in another. In addition to maps for Brazil, NAVTEQ provides maps in Latin America for Argentina,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Mexico, Peru and Venezuela. A dedicated technical customer support team is available to assist customers with integrating NAVTEQ maps into applications. 

NAVTEQ maps are unique in their representation of real-world driving conditions. In Brazil, dozens of NAVTEQ geographic analysts, located in Sao Paulo, Rio de Janeiro, Porto Alegre and Recife use local knowledge and local contacts to collect and verify details of the roads. They drive thousands of kilometers each year and have local knowledge of road network changes helping to make NAVTEQ maps the freshest and most up-to-date.

About DL - Digital Life

Digital Life was established in 2008 and is located in the neighborhood of Santa Rita do Sapucaí, Minas Gerais, Brazil. The company is focused on producing hi-tech electronics. With its strict quality control and mass market penetration via retailers such as Walmart, Carrefour and Lojas Americanas, Digital Life maintains more than 5,000 points of sales throughout Brazil.

About NAVTEQ

NAVTEQ is the leading global provider of digital map, traffic and location data that enables navigation and location-based platforms around the world.  NAVTEQ supplies comprehensive digital map information to power automotive navigation systems, portable and wireless devices, Internet-based mapping applications and government and business solutions.  The Chicago-based company was founded in 1985 and has approximately 4,400 employees located in 195 offices and in 44 countries.
